WebFeb 21, 2024 · Urine total protein: ≥3.5 g/day. The presence of nephrotic-range proteinuria with edema, hypoalbuminemia (&lt;3.0 g/dL), and hyperlipidemia is defined as nephrotic syndrome. Glomerular proteinuria. … WebWhat are the 3 causes of proteinuria. Glomerular-Increased glomerular permeability to large molecular weight proteins such as albumin. Tubular-Incomplete tubular reabsorption of normally filtered low molecular weight proteins. Overproduction-Increased production of low molecular weight proteins as in Ig light chains. - ex multiple myeloma.

Reclassification is therefore limited, but when present, is generally indicative of the presence of CV risk factors and prognosis. rockport boys 7 hiking shoesWebStoring a urine sample. If you can't hand your urine sample in within 1 hour, you should put the container in a sealed plastic bag then store it in the fridge at around 4C.
